Valtris Specialty Chemicals Company
Santicizer® 141
Chemical Name:
2-Ethylhexyldiphenyl Phosphate Ester
Chemical Family:
Phosphate Esters, Phosphorous-based Compounds, Organophosphates
Functions:
Plasticizer, Processing Aid, Flame Retardant
Labeling Claims:
Halogen-free, Food Contact Acceptable
Compatible Substrates & Surfaces:
Textiles
Synonyms:
2-Ethylhexyl diphenyl phosphate, Diphenyl 2-ethylhexyl phosphate, Disflamoll DPO, EHDPP, Octicizer
Santicizer® 141 is a fast-fusing, non-halogen, fire retardant plasticizer used in multiple polymer systems. This plasticizer is recommended for applications where there is a need to reduce the risk of fire. This versatile additive has FDA clearances making it an option for applications that involve indirect food contact. In PVC, Santicizer® 141 acts as a high solvating plasticizer, offering performance, faster fusion and high plasticizing efficiency. Santicizer® 141 is also used as a lubricant additive, hydraulic fluid, and rubber processing aid.
